Rose's Three-Straight 30+ Point Efforts Rank High in IWU Hoop History

11/27/2018 3:29:00 PM

BLOOMINGTON, Ill. -- When senior guard Brady Rose scored 30+ points in three straight games earlier this season, he joined an elite group of Illinois Wesleyan men's basketball players in the past 50 years who have scored at such a prolific clip over a span of games.

A look at the history books reveals the following, dating back to 1968-69:
 
30+ POINTS IN THREE STRAIGHT GAMES
2018-19           Rose (34-Calvin, 30-Alma, 33-WashU)
1988-89           Jeff Kuehl (30-Aurora, 32-Elmhurst, 33-Carthage); Kuehl had eight 30+ games in 1988-89 and missed the final five games with a broken hand
1983-84           Blaise Bugajski (38-Carroll, 32-Millikin, 32-Wis.-Whitewater); Bugajski had 10 30+ games in 1983-84
1980-81           Greg Yess (30-DePauw, 32-Quincy, school-record 47-Indiana Central); Yess had six 30+ games in 1980-81
1976-77           Jack Sikma (38-Carthage, 33-North Central, 33-Elmhurst)
                        Sikma (31-St. Augustine, 33-Hawaii-Hilo, 31-Henderson State); Sikma had 10 30+ games in 1976-77
 
30+ POINTS IN BACK-TO-BACK GAMES
2010-11           Sean  Johnson (35-Monmouth, 34- Dominican)
1999-00           Korey Coon (30-Wheaton, 42-North Central)
1996-97           Bryan Crabtree (33-North Central, 30-Elmhurst); Crabtree had seven 30+ games in 1996-97
1995-96           Crabtree (40-Millikin, 31-Ripon)
1990-91           David Caldwell (30-Augustana, 30-Wheaton)
1983-84           Bugajski (40-Kearney State, 40-Midwestern State)
1982-83           Bugajski (32-Wheaton, 34-Eureka)
1978-79           Al Black (32-Wis.-Platteville, 31-Augustana)
1972-73           Dean Gravlin (35-Carroll, 31-Carthage)
